Sensory rhodopsin II from the haloalkaliphilic natronobacterium pharaonis: light-activated proton transfer reactions.
Biophysical journal - 1 Feb 2000
Schmies G, Lüttenberg B, Chizhov I, Engelhard M, Becker A, Bamberg E
Abstract excerpt
In the present work the light-activated proton transfer reactions of sensory rhodopsin II from Natronobacterium pharaonis (pSRII) and those of the channel-mutants D75N-pSRII and F86D-pSRII are investigated using flash photolysis and black lipid membrane (BLM) techniques.
